Uber Technologies Inc. said it received 5,981 reports of sexual assault involving U.S. passengers or drivers during 2017 and 2018, underscoring the risk that has been a chief criticism of ride-hailing companies around the world. In a report released Thursday, Uber voluntarily disclosed the first comprehensive review of safety issues involving its ride service.
